DNS辅服务器未响应是一个常见的网络问题,它通常意味着当主DNS服务器无法正常工作时,备用的DNS服务器(即辅服务器)也无法提供域名解析服务,以下是对这个问题的详细解释:
一、DNS辅服务器未响应的含义
1、DNS基础功能
DNS(Domain Name System,域名系统)是互联网的基础服务之一,它的主要功能是将人类可读的域名(如www.example.com)转换为机器可读的IP地址(如192.0.0.1)。
当用户在浏览器中输入一个网址时,浏览器会向DNS服务器发送请求,以获取该网址对应的IP地址,如果主DNS服务器无法响应,通常会有一个或多个辅服务器作为备份来提供解析服务。
2、辅服务器的角色
辅服务器的主要作用是在主DNS服务器不可用时,接管域名解析任务,确保网站的持续可用性。
如果辅服务器也未响应,那么用户将无法通过域名访问网站,导致网络连接失败。
二、DNS辅服务器未响应的原因
1、网络问题
本地网络连接不稳定或中断,导致无法与DNS服务器通信。
路由器或调制解调器故障,影响网络数据传输。
2、DNS服务器问题
辅DNS服务器本身宕机或过载,无法处理请求。
DNS服务器配置错误,如IP地址设置错误。
DNS缓存问题,导致解析结果不准确或过期。
3、安全软件与防火墙
防火墙或安全软件阻止了与DNS服务器的通信。
恶意软件感染,篡改了DNS设置或劫持了DNS请求。
4、ISP问题
互联网服务提供商(ISP)的DNS服务出现故障或维护。
ISP的网络连接不稳定或中断。
5、其他因素
操作系统或浏览器配置错误,影响了DNS解析过程。
网络攻击,如DDoS攻击,导致DNS服务器过载或瘫痪。
三、解决DNS辅服务器未响应的方法
1、检查网络连接
确保设备已正确连接到互联网,并且网络连接稳定。
重启路由器和调制解调器,以刷新网络连接。
2、更换DNS服务器
如果当前使用的DNS服务器出现问题,可以尝试更换为公共DNS服务器,如Google的8.8.8.8和8.8.4.4,或Cloudflare的1.1.1.1。
在网络设置中手动更改DNS服务器地址。
3、清除DNS缓存
在Windows系统中,打开命令提示符并输入ipconfig /flushdns
来清除DNS缓存。
在macOS系统中,打开终端并输入sudo killall HUP mDNSResponder
来刷新DNS缓存。
4、检查防火墙和安全软件
确保防火墙和安全软件没有阻止与DNS服务器的通信。
暂时禁用防火墙和安全软件进行测试,如果问题解决,则调整其设置以允许DNS请求通过。
5、联系ISP
如果以上方法都无法解决问题,可能是ISP的DNS服务出现故障,联系ISP客服寻求帮助。
6、更新软件与驱动程序
确保操作系统、浏览器和网卡驱动程序都是最新版本,以避免因软件过时导致的兼容性问题。
DNS辅服务器未响应是一个涉及多个方面的复杂问题,通过逐步排查网络连接、DNS服务器设置、防火墙与安全软件以及ISP服务等方面的问题,通常可以找到并解决这一问题,保持系统和软件的更新也是预防此类问题的重要措施。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/104330.html